Hydropower stays one of the most trusted and consistent resources of sustainable power, contributing substantially to global power production. Large-scale dams, such as the Three Gorges Dam in China and the Hoover Dam in the USA, have actually long been sources of hydroelectric power, providing tidy energy to countless people. Nevertheless, modern-day hydropower is advancing past traditional dam frameworks, with smaller sized, a lot more environmentally friendly run-of-river jobs obtaining appeal. Pumped storage hydropower is additionally playing a vital function in power storage space, serving as a natural battery by saving excess electrical energy and launching it when needed. Countries like Norway and copyright are leading in hydropower manufacturing, benefiting from their abundant water sources to maintain a consistent power supply. Firms such as Andritz Hydro, Voith Hydro, and General Electric Hydro are developing advanced hydroelectric technology to more info enhance effectiveness and decrease ecological impact. Hydropower's ability to supply consistent, large power makes it a cornerstone of eco-friendly electrical power generation, complementing recurring resources such as wind and solar to produce a balanced and resistant power grid.

Renewable resource is leading the way in sustainable electrical energy generation, with solar power playing a substantial function in this makeover. Photovoltaic or pv panels are currently a lot more efficient and budget friendly than ever before, permitting services and homes to harness the power of the sun to satisfy their power needs. With widespread adoption, solar ranches are becoming significant contributors to nationwide power grids, minimizing the dependency on standard power resources. Nations like China, the USA, and India are purchasing massive solar jobs, driving advancement and lowering costs. In addition to photovoltaic panels, concentrated solar power (CSP) innovation is obtaining traction, utilizing mirrors to concentrate sunshine and generate heat, which consequently creates power. Companies such as Initial Solar, SunPower, and Canadian Solar go to the forefront of this solar change, pushing the borders of efficiency and sustainability. With governments offering motivations and aids, the rapid expansion of solar power is readied to continue, reinforcing its function as a crucial pillar of the renewable energy activity.

Wind power is one more essential part of the renewable energy field, using the natural force of the wind to generate tidy electricity. Offshore and onshore wind ranches are increasing rapidly, with turbines becoming larger, much more effective, and significantly cost-efficient. The UK, Germany, and Denmark are blazing a trail in overseas wind development, buying high-capacity tasks that offer consistent energy outcome. Wind ranches are now being integrated with power storage space options, making certain a consistent power supply also during periods of reduced wind activity. Firms such as Siemens Gamesa, Vestas, and GE Renewable resource are introducing wind generator innovation, making it feasible to produce more electrical power with fewer wind turbines. Breakthroughs in drifting wind modern technology are also opening brand-new possibilities for deep-sea installments, raising the capacity for wind power generation in seaside regions. The wind power sector is creating hundreds of jobs while substantially minimizing international carbon exhausts, confirming that clean energy is not just an environmental necessity yet additionally an economic chance for future generations.
